The Verdict: Which is Better?
When placing Organic Vanilla Animal Cookies and Crispy Oatmeal Granola Cookies side-by-side, the nutritional differences become quite clear. Both products cater to specific dietary needs, but picking the right one depends on whether you are prioritizing weight loss, muscle gain, or clean eating.
Organic Vanilla Animal Cookies is the more energy-dense option here, packing 5 more calories per 100g than Crispy Oatmeal Granola Cookies. If you are looking for sustained energy or fueling a workout, this higher caloric density might be an advantage.
In terms of sugar control, Organic Vanilla Animal Cookies takes the lead with only 23.3g of sugar per 100g, whereas Crispy Oatmeal Granola Cookies contains 26.92g. Lower sugar content is often linked to better metabolic health.
Looking to build muscle? Organic Vanilla Animal Cookies offers a protein boost with 6.67g per 100g, outperforming Crispy Oatmeal Granola Cookies in this category.
